To solve this, we analyze the medical terms: "dyspnea" means difficult breathing, and "tachypnea" means rapid breathing (from the prefix "tachy-" meaning rapid). So we match this to the option with difficult and rapid breathing.

The word part "laryngo-" comes from medical terminology, where "laryngo-" refers to the larynx, which is the voice box. We eliminate other options: "lip" is related to "cheilo-", "neck" to "cervico-", and "tongue" to "glosso-".
